Just finished the ACSD removal, and figured I would post my few comments.
I started to strip the 5mm allen key. So i removed the 12mm nut holding the spring thingy on. removed spring and then had a clear view to all the 5mm heads. I found this worked great and saved me drilling out the bolts.
